Since technically, until the dues come up in December, I'm the "owner" of the website, I'll field this one.

The site in question is Meetup. I chose to go Meetup over some of the other more popular options for a number of reasons. I did actually use Warhorn for awhile, but I find that its functionality is actually better suited for managing one-off events, not ongoing game days. After shopping around, I realized how much I used Meetup for other local events and decided to try it out. Personally I couldn't be happier.

Some of the befits?

First off there's the free advertising. We regularly get 2-3 new members joining up and asking to go to games because the cross-reference advertising that Meetup does for all of its groups. In essence, once you join up with a Minneapolis Roleplayer meetup, you might get an on-screen notice that you may also want to join the Minneapolis/St. Paul Pathfinder Society.

There's the broad functionality of the communication. We get messageboards (with all of the standard moderation functionality), mailing lists, and the ability to shoot off e-mail blasts to select members of the group. Game day reminders are automated so we don't have to manually remember to do them as well. The members also have the ability to talk about game days both before and after (and they do).

Finally there are a lot of tools to watch to see trends. We can count players per day, we can see number of active/inactive players, and I can even pull excel tables for analysis of all the analytics. As a data driven person myself, this was always very valuable.

It's easy to set-up and really takes no effort to maintain, so it wound up being a perfect application for us.
